Key Highlights
Recent footage examined by BBC Verify highlights a shift in Hezbollah’s drone capabilities, specifically the use of fibre-optic guided unmanned aerial vehicles. Unlike traditional radio-controlled drones, fibre-optic tethered systems are immune to electronic jamming and can maintain stable video feeds over longer distances. The videos, released by Hezbollah’s media wing, document attacks targeting Israeli surveillance positions, radar installations, and military infrastructure near the Lebanon-Israel border.
The analysis underscores a notable refinement in operational precision. Drones filmed in daylight and night missions appear to strike designated structures with consistent accuracy, suggesting advanced guidance systems and pilot training. BBC Verify cross-referenced geolocation data from the footage, confirming that several strikes hit sites inside Israeli-controlled territory. The use of fibre-optic cables also reduces the risk of signal interception, making countermeasures more challenging.
These tactics reflect a broader regional trend of non-state actors leveraging low-cost, commercially available drone technology for asymmetric warfare. Hezbollah’s evolving arsenal has drawn attention from defense analysts, who note that such systems could potentially pose new challenges for conventional air defense networks.

Expert Insights
From an investment perspective, the evolving drone tactics highlight emerging risks and opportunities within the defense and aerospace sector. Companies developing counter-drone systems—such as jamming devices, laser-based interceptors, and radar-guided detection networks—may see heightened interest from government procurement agencies. Similarly, firms specializing in secure communications and cyber resilience could benefit as militaries seek to protect increasingly networked operations.
However, the geopolitical situation remains fluid. Any escalation along the Israel-Lebanon border would likely increase risk premiums for equities and bonds in the region, particularly for firms with direct exposure to Israeli or Lebanese markets. Oil and gas infrastructure in the Eastern Mediterranean, including recent offshore discoveries, could face disruption premiums, though current production has not been affected.
Analysts caution that the long-term impact on defense budgets depends on whether such tactics become widespread among other armed groups. NATO and allied countries may accelerate investments in electronic warfare and anti-drone training, potentially benefiting specialized defense firms. On the other hand, broader conflict could weigh on regional tourism, technology exports, and foreign direct investment.
Investors should monitor official statements from defense ministries and intelligence assessments for updates on technology adoption. Given the rapid pace of drone innovation, any significant shift in battlefield effectiveness could alter procurement cycles and vendor selection for years to come.
